Description: Inpatient Physical Therapist – Full-Time Location: Mishawaka, IN Schedule: Full-Time, 8:00 - 4:30pm Monday - Friday with weekend rotations

Are you passionate about providing therapy in a collaborative, patient-centered environment? Join a dynamic, multidisciplinary team where Physical Therapists are respected and valued contributors to the care team. From evaluation and skilled intervention to discharge planning, you’ll play a vital role in improving patient outcomes and enhancing the hospital experience. We foster a culture of continuous improvement, professional growth, and teamwork—where your leadership and interdisciplinary skills can truly shine.

At our organization, therapists are integral to the care journey. You’ll be part of a supportive department culture focused on collaboration, stewardship, and excellence in patient care.

What You’ll Do

  • Evaluate patients and develop individualized treatment plans based on clinical findings and patient goals

  • Provide skilled therapeutic interventions to promote recovery and functional independence

  • Collaborate with physicians, nurses, and fellow therapists to ensure coordinated care

  • Educate patients and families on therapy goals, progress, and home programs

  • Accurately document evaluations, treatment sessions, and discharge summaries

  • Participate in interdisciplinary team meetings and hospital initiatives

  • Support a culture of safety, quality, and continuous improvement

What We’re Looking For

  • Bachelor’s degree (minimum) in Physical Therapy from an accredited academic program

  • Must be licensed as a Physical Therapist in the State of Indiana

  • Current CPR certification

  • Previous clinical experience preferred

  • New graduates welcome

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ills

  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ment

  • Commitment to patient-centered care and professional development
